68hc11a1 memory map software

Code in external memory must be changed to add the bprot clearing instructions. Errors found in 68hc11 programming reference guide bible 21aug98 errors in miller textbook 21may99 known bugs in as11. Modern computers have no need for this hole, but some chipsets still support it as an optional feature and some motherboards may still allow it to be enabled with bios options, so it may exist in a modern computers with no isa. External memory of 32k ram lower half of memory map, and 32k eeprom upper half is provided. The other fifteen address bits a0 through a14 determine the address within that 32k. Memorymap started the outdoor digital mapping revolution back in 2001 and today hundreds of thousands of customers rely on our award winning software on. Memory map navigator is a fullfeatured gps ready navigation package that displays high quality raster images of topographic maps, nautical charts, aerial photos and more. The second set of services, collectively known as the mmap services, is typically used for mapping files, although it may be used for creating shared memory segments as well all operations valid on memory resulting from mmap of a file are valid on memory resulting from mmap of a block device. Dump the memory locations to check and verify the data stored in. Observing register locations via the memory view is considered to be secretly peeking at the values, and does not count as a read in those cases where reading. Two 16 bit index registers are present x,y to provide indexing to anywhere in the memory map. Ad11mx1 provides 32k ram lower half of memory map and an empty 28pin dip socket mapped to the upper half. If this is correct, it is up to you and your application.

Making effective use of memory, understanding memory map of. An introduction software and hardware interfacing, 2nd edition huang, hanuei, chartrand, leo on. This causes your program to execute at the address you specified. Microcore11 satisfies the needs of users who want lots of memory, but only require a modest number of io lines. Fully associative mapping in fully associative mapping, a block of main memory can map to any line of the cache that is freely available at that moment.

From the software developers point of view, memorymapped io devices look very. A 64k version with an additional 32k ram piggybacked on top of the 32k eeprom chip is also available. Frankly i think the software is a generation or two out of date but there is no other way i know of to get such flexible mapping of the uk. Your program may exist at any executable location in the processor memory map. In the simplest case the talker is placed in an external memory and is run whenever the hc11 is powered up. Hc11 microcontrollers mc68hc711d3 mc68hc11d3 mc68hc11d0 mc68l11d0 data sheet mc68hc711d3 rev. Motorola semiconductor engineering bulletin replacing 68hc11a. To download the memory map app for pc, mac, iphone or ipad, or android click here. Eb193 4 motorola engineering bulletin introduction difference. The ram is mapped in the lower half of the 68hc11s memory map, with holes in the memory map for the internal ram and register block. Software distribution and documentation 68hc1112 assembler. The ftok subroutine provides the key that the shmget subroutine uses to create the shared segment.

Is it possible to substitue a mc68hc711e9 chip in place of a mc68hc11a1 cpu. None, eeprom not in memory map f r e e s c a l e s e m i c o n d u c t o. Since the talker is interrupt driven, and resides in the same memory map as user software, certain vectors must be reserved for the talker code. There is an engineering bulletin on the motorolafreescale web site on upgrading from the a series to the e series. The top half 32 kbytes of the address space at addresses 0x8000 to 0xffff addresses a common memory page that is always visible i. Block fill memory with 00, so you have the following. However, after reset, the ram is entirely visible by the cpu. Motorola semiconductor engineering bulletin replacing. Installing or reinstalling the memory map software how to uninstall memory map connecting a garmin gps to memory map memory map ais on the pc ive downloaded the licence file but i cant run it gps debug file printing. Use topographic maps or nautical charts offline mapping software download it free today. The isa memory hole from 0x00f00000 to 0x00ffffff was used for memory mapped isa devices e. Mapping software for pc iphone ipad android mac memory map. Memory is observable and alterable via the memory view display panel.

Download the memory map iphoneipad app from the app store. A compromise is possible if a talker is loaded into the hc11s internal eeprom. No external address and data bus functions cpu can only access onchip memory ii. The 68hc11 devices are more powerful and more expensive than the 68hc08 microcontrollers, and are. In computer science, a memory map is a structure of data which usually resides in memory itself that indicates how memory is laid out. The remap signal is used to provide a different memory map at reset, when rom is required at address 0, and during normal operation, when ram may be used. The associative memory stores both the address and content of the memory word. Memory map and registers interfacing cprograms with arm. Br ef0c and set the break instructions to the last memory.

With memory map i have a seemless map of my area and i can print out an a4 sheet of any area i am going mountain biking in, laminate it on my home laminator which was very cheap and a better solution than expensive paper and stick it in any pocket not just a map specific pocket. The technique used to map the memory to the upper 32k block is fairly simple. Mc68hc711d3, mc68hc11d3, mc68hc11d0, mc68l11d0 data sheet. Maps are downloaded onthefly and can be preloaded so that they can be used offline. Now produced by nxp semiconductors, it descended from the motorola 6800 microprocessor by way of the 6809. You type in a date 25 years previous and step out into a world where people are actually using the motorola 68hc11 microcontroller. The memory map app turns your phone or tablet into a fullfeatured outdoor gps or marine chart plotter, and allows you to navigate with usgs topo maps, noaa marine charts, and may other specialist maps, even without a wireless internet signal. The 68hc11 6811 or hc11 for short is an 8bit microcontroller c family introduced by motorola in 1984. The program actually runs an object code representation of the assembled program, denoted the. This makes fully associative mapping more flexible than direct mapping. Microprocessors store their programs and data in memory. Indeed, if you want to make the cpu see the entire eeprom, you need to move it, because it is overlapped by the register.

The motorola 68hc11 reference manual book the pink book. The motorola simulator, also called as wookie simulator is a program that runs motorola 68hc11 code. Enter your program as source code on the development host using a plain text editor. Programming the motorola 68hc11 lab free class notes.

Programming the motorola 68hc11 lab free class notes online. Video created by university of colorado boulder for the course embedded software and hardware architecture. It is useful in simulating experiments involving the motorola 68hc11 microcontroller. The processors native address space is only 64k, so a paging architecture is used to expand the addressable memory to 1 mbyte. Introduction to 68hc11 microcontroller authorstream. In this mode, all software needed to control the mcu is contained in internal. The module uses an inexpensive 8bit implementation of motorolas mc68hc16z1 microcontroller c to collect. In configurations which have only 8k eeprom, the 8k block appears redundantly, at each 8k boundary in the upper half of the memory map. Memorymap ordnance survey maps, admiralty marine charts, caa. Supports 68hc11a0, 68hc11a1, 68hc11a7, 68hc11a8, 68hc11e0, 68hc11e1, 68hc811e2, 68hc11e8, 68hc11e9, 68hc711e9, 68hc11e20 and 68hc711e20 the 68hc11a1 plcc chip is in a socket. This is the current version of the memory map navigator software. All software needed to control mcu must be in internal memory iv.

A memory map for a realmode x86 processor with memorymapped io. The basis of this map is the versatile express rs2 memory map with extensions. The handheld uses a paged memory system to expand the processors 64kbyte address space to 2 megabytes of addressable memory. Memory is organized as a contiguous string of addresses, or locations. Once the app and maps are loaded to the phone or tablet, cellular. You will receive a brandnew 68hc11a1 processor chip, a 52pin plcc socket for the cpu, an 8mhz ceramic resonator to generate the cpu clock signal, an 8k static ram memory chip, an 8position dip switch, and a 6gang block of leds they are discrete within the block for making indicators. Eel 4744 software and documentation university of florida. The registers initrm, initrg, and initee and also misc for the 68hc912b32 can be changed to alter the memory map. Download mapping software from memory map, online mapping software downloads including topographic maps, 3d elevation data, noaa charts and more. Whenever the 68hc11s a15 the highestorder address bit is logic one, an address in the upper 32k is being selected. Gps mapping software for pc, iphone, ipad, android, mac. Thank you very much for purchasing our 68hc11 evbplus2 rev.

Appendix b 1 introduction pinouts for sb connector option 1. How our software with ordnance survey, caa and admiralty maps and charts makes navigation safer, easier and more fun. Br ef0c and set the break instructions to the last memory location 6. In direct mapping, the physical address is divided as 2. Cache mapping cache mapping techniques gate vidyalay.

Common memory is accessible from any page, and paged memory comprises sixty four 16k pages located at addresses 0x8000 to 0xbfff on pages 0x00 through 0x3f. Memory map navigator, windows pc mapping software this is the fully featured gps mapping and navigation software that drives everything. The decoder controls the memory map of the system, and generates a slave select signal for each memory region. The memory map in single board computer application.

None, eeprom not in memory map eb193 motorola 5 engineering bulletin difference, depending on. In native debugger programs, a memory map refers to the mapping between loaded executablelibrary files and memory regions. Click here to enroll in our beta test program and try out the latest features. It is the fastest and most flexible cache organization that uses an associative memory. Each memory location contains eight bits of data this is because the 68hc11 is an 8bit micro.

The memorymap app turns your phone or tablet into a fullfeatured outdoor gps or marine chart plotter, and allows you to navigate with usgs topo maps. The board comes with a 68hc11a1 chip, or a 68hc11e1 chip. The term memory map can have a different meanings in different contexts. This monitor has the cleanest code of all the apple ii monitors. Also has a disassembler, memory dump, memory move, memory compare, step and trace functions, lores graphics routines, multiply and divide routines, and more.

254 581 1071 1043 1308 107 1260 1493 1229 546 1189 659 701 290 118 1476 363 1610 350 1472 564 69 928 704 898 947 1147 300 1163 1156 66 915 909 1388 1136